Course Details

Railway Infrastructure Development: An overview of railway infrastructure development, including new constructions, upgrades, and expansions. This unit covers the primary and secondary keywords.
Feasibility Study Methodologies: An exploration of the methodologies used in conducting feasibility studies for railway investments, including cost-benefit analysis, risk assessment, and financial modeling.
Economic and Financial Analysis: A deep dive into the economic and financial analysis of railway investments, including revenue projections, capital budgeting, and return on investment calculations.
Market Analysis and Demand Forecasting: Techniques for analyzing market demand and forecasting passenger and freight traffic for railway investments.
Environmental and Social Considerations: An examination of environmental and social considerations in railway investment projects, including sustainability, community engagement, and stakeholder management.
Regulatory Frameworks and Standards: An overview of the regulatory frameworks and standards governing railway investments, including safety, accessibility, and interoperability.
Project Management and Delivery: Best practices for project management and delivery of railway investment projects, including planning, scheduling, and resource allocation.
Risk Management and Mitigation: Techniques for ident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ks in railway investment projects, including financial, operational, and regulatory risks.
Ethics and Corporate Governance: An examination of ethical considerations and corporate governance in railway investment projects, including transparency, accountability, and stakeholder communication.

Career Path

The Professional Certificate in Railway Investment Feasibility is designed to equip learners with the skills to become successful railway investment analysts, infrastructure project managers, transportation planners, and cost engineers within the UK rail industry. Railway Investment Analyst: Professionals in this role analyze railway investment projects, evaluating their feasibility and potential return on investment. With a steady job market and competitive salary ranges, this role is ideal for those with strong analytical skills and an interest in the railway industry. Infrastructure Project Manager: As an infrastructure project manager, you'll oversee the planning, execution, and delivery of railway infrastructure projects, ensuring they are completed on time and within budget. With a growing demand for skilled professionals in this area, this role offers a rewarding career path with a positive job outlook. Transportation Planner: Transportation planners are responsible for developing strategies to improve railway transportation systems, optimizing routes, and increasing operational efficiency. This role requires a deep understanding of transportation systems and strong problem-solving skills, making it an excellent fit for those with a passion for improving the UK's railway infrastructure. Cost Engineer: Cost engineers work closely with project managers and analysts to estimate, control, and reduce project costs, ensuring railway investment projects remain financially viable. With a strong focus on data analysis and financial management, this role offers a challenging yet rewarding career path within the railway investment sector.
